diff --git a/internal_packages/composer-signature/lib/preferences-signatures.jsx b/internal_packages/composer-signature/lib/preferences-signatures.jsx index 0a73a7b3c..fbc64a2ee 100644 --- a/internal_packages/composer-signature/lib/preferences-signatures.jsx +++ b/internal_packages/composer-signature/lib/preferences-signatures.jsx @@ -102,7 +102,7 @@ export default class PreferencesSignatures extends React.Component {
- +
) diff --git a/internal_packages/preferences/lib/tabs/update-channel-section.jsx b/internal_packages/preferences/lib/tabs/update-channel-section.jsx index 9434c821b..5df7a90d5 100644 --- a/internal_packages/preferences/lib/tabs/update-channel-section.jsx +++ b/internal_packages/preferences/lib/tabs/update-channel-section.jsx @@ -58,10 +58,17 @@ class UpdateChannelSection extends React.Component { render() { const {current, available, saving} = this.state; + // HACK: Temporarily do not allow users to move on to the Salesforce channel. + // In the future we could implement this server-side via a "public" flag. + let allowed = available; + if (current && current.name.toLowerCase() !== 'salesforce') { + allowed = available.filter(c => c.name.toLowerCase() !== 'salesforce'); + } + return (
Updates
- +